site stats

Cyclomatic complexity is 13 max allowed is 10

WebCyclomatic complexity is a way to determine if your code needs to be refactored. The code is analyzed and a complexity number is determined. Complexity is determine by … WebSee the GNU 13 // Lesser General Public License for more details. 14 // 15 // You should have received a copy of the GNU Lesser General Public 16 // License along with this library; if not, write to the Free Software 17 // Foundation, Inc., 59 Temple Place, Suite 330, Boston, MA 02111-1307 USA 18 ///// 19 20 package com.puppycrawl.tools ...

Metrics :: RuboCop Docs

WebAug 21, 2024 · Cyclomatic Complexity is 11 ( max allowed is 10 ) in Java code java 15,882 I'd go ahead and extract your code of the "Voice" case to another method. (You … WebNed Batchelder’s McCabe script. Flake8 runs all the tools by launching the single flake8 script. It displays the warnings in a per-file, merged output. It also adds a few features: files that contain this line are skipped: # flake8: noqa. lines that contain a # noqa comment at the end will not issue warnings. a Git and a Mercurial hook. learn telugu language in hindi https://ezstlhomeselling.com

What does the

WebJul 29, 2013 · So ideally the resulting function will just have one if statement which determines which result is used. The next step is to extract all boolean code into variables. Eg var leftPastCenter = this.content.getBoundingClientRect ().left > viewport / 2. Finally, use boolean logic to simplify it step by step. WebCyclomatic complexity measures the number of linearly independent paths through a program’s source code. This rule allows setting a cyclomatic complexity threshold. … learn tema 4

US11593096B1 Systems and methods for measuring complexity …

Category:metric definition - SonarQube

Tags:Cyclomatic complexity is 13 max allowed is 10

Cyclomatic complexity is 13 max allowed is 10

Solved This kind of error appears, but how can I fix

WebMay 19, 2013 · The simple explanation is how many “paths” there are in the flow of your code. Or it could be described as the number of possible outcomes for a function/method. Hence my suggested update to the documentation, with the following example code included. The NPath complexity of a method is the number of acyclic execution paths … WebSeverity Category Rule Message Line Warning: metrics: CyclomaticComplexity: Cyclomatic Complexity is 13 (max allowed is 10). 57 Warning: metrics: NPathComplexity

Cyclomatic complexity is 13 max allowed is 10

Did you know?

WebThe cyclomatic number is equal to the number of linearly independent paths through a program in its graphs representation. For a program control graph G, cyclomatic number, V (G), is given as: V (G) = E - N + 2 * P E = The number of edges in graphs G N = The number of nodes in graphs G P = The number of connected components in graph G. Example: Web问题 代码没有提示: 许多刚接触rn开发的非前端同学,都会问“哪个编辑器有智能提示?”。。。而对于前端同学来说,现在的日子已经好很多了,要什么自行车。 低级代码错误: 这里的错误是指类似拼写错误,符号错误等。写完代码,跑起来各种报错,有时候费死劲的找,最后发现是个中文的 ...

WebComplexity Complexity ( complexity ): Complexity refers to Cyclomatic complexity, a quantitative metric used to calculate the number of paths through the code. Whenever the control flow of a function splits, the complexity counter gets incremented by one. Each function has a minimum complexity of 1. WebCyclomaticComplexity. Since: PHPMD 0.1. Complexity is determined by the number of decision points in a method plus one for the method entry. The decision points are 'if', 'while', 'for', and 'case labels'. Generally, 1-4 is low complexity, 5-7 indicates moderate complexity, 8-10 is high complexity, and 11+ is very high complexity.

WebCyclomatic complexityis a software metricused to indicate the complexity of a program. It is a quantitative measure of the number of linearly independent paths through a program's source code. It was developed by Thomas J. McCabe, Sr.in 1976. WebOct 25, 2024 · cyclomaticComplexity = edges - nodes + 2. Note: If you’re curious about this formula or where the +2 came from, check out the very detailed Wikipedia Article on the …

WebEvery function and block will be ranked from A (best complexity score) to F (worst one). This ranks is based on the ranks of complexity of the Python Radon. Rank Risk Alow - simple block Blow - well structured and stable block Cmoderate - slightly complex block Dmore than moderate - more complex block Ehigh - complex block, alarming

WebMar 25, 2024 · Steps to be followed: The following steps should be followed for computing Cyclomatic complexity and test cases design. Step 1 – Construction of graph with nodes and edges from the code. Step 2 – Identification of independent paths. Step 3 – Cyclomatic Complexity Calculation. Step 4 – Design of Test Cases. learn telugu through tamil pdf free downloadWebCyclomatic complexity is a measurement developed by Thomas McCabe to determine the stability and level of confidence in a program. It measures the number of linearly … learn telugu through hindiWebCyclomatic complexity measures the number of linearly independent paths through a program's source code. This rule allows setting a cyclomatic complexity threshold. function a(x) { if (true) { return x; // 1st path } else if (false) { return x+1; // 2nd path } else { return 4; // 3rd path } } Rule Details how to do legendary mode terrariaWebThis kind of error appears, but how can I fix it? error : Cyclomatic Complexity is 13 (max allowed is 10). I think a more helper method is necessary, but what should I do? public … how to do legal symbol in wordWeb参考: Cyclomatic Complexity Revisited 循環的複雑度が10を超えるとバグ混入確率がゆるやかに上昇していっているので、1つの関数の循環的複雑度は10以内に抑えるようにコードを書くようにするといいでしょう。 ESLintでの検証 ESLintはJavaScriptの静的解析ツールです。 参考: ESLint 最初の一歩 - Qiita ESLintには様々なルールがありますが、循環的 … how to do legendary psiopsWebMar 6, 2024 · Cyclomatic Complexity is 11 ( max allowed is 10 ) in Java code. I have the following java code that violets the checkstyle saying that " Cyclomatic Complexity is 11 ( max allowed is 10 )" public boolean validate (final BindingResult bindingResult) { boolean … how to do legend in matlabWebJun 20, 2024 · Steps that should be followed in calculating cyclomatic complexity and test cases design are: Construction of graph with nodes … learn telugu through tamil pdf